Meltdown Mitigation: Instant Sensory Resets

Even the most carefully planned itinerary can be derailed by a sudden altitude change or an unexpected delay on the tarmac. Preventing full-blown meltdowns requires having immediate, physical resets ready to deploy the second you notice your toddler getting fussy. Fast, tactile intervention is the secret to maintaining a peaceful cabin environment for everyone.

The Ice Cup Reset:

If a tantrum is brewing, ask the flight attendant for a simple plastic cup filled with ice cubes and a spoon; transferring the ice or feeling the cold texture acts as an immediate sensory reset for an overstimulated nervous system.

Pack Gel Window Clings:

Bring a pack of cheap, reusable gel window clings and let your child stick them directly onto the airplane window or the tray table, providing a completely silent activity that requires fine motor focus and peels off cleanly.
